Output 23f3cac56a4f884358ac42ed6dac75e5ca572d746c33724650f4830bfcba712d:0

value
14664000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c5b66fc17d9594d38a061c013c11b744e7959b5 OP_EQUALVERIFY OP_CHECKSIG
address
153YEBbBpLwKN2K4GKwaar1BVZgRu35FkU
transaction
23f3cac56a4f884358ac42ed6dac75e5ca572d746c33724650f4830bfcba712d
spent
true